Obituary of
Mary Elizabeth Allen
July 7, 1980
Mary Elizabeth Allen 58, of Mill Road, died Sunday at Memorial Hospital following a sudden illness.
Services will be at 10:30 a.m. Tuesday at Trinity Episcopal
Church with the Rev. Peter W. Peters officiating. Burial will be in Greenwood
Cemetery.
The remains will be at Tarpley’s Funeral Home until
the hour of services.
A housewife, Mrs. Allen was born in Winchester, Tenn., May 27, 1922, the daughter of Enoch M. Farmer and the late Ida George Farmer.
She was a member of Trinity Episcopal Church.
Survivors are one son, Dr. William Bailey Allen Jr.. Clarksville; one daughter, Amelia Hartz, Clarksville; one sister, Louise Dismukes, Donelson, Tenn.; and four gandchildren.
Pallbearers will be Ed Dismukes Jr., Tom Foust. Charles Persinger, Rob Winn, Bill Shelton and Brad Martin.
The family asks that in lieu of flowers and other remembrances,
donations be made to the Trinity Episcopal Church’s Memorial Fund.
